Building a Comprehensive Resource Directory for Students
As educational landscapes continually evolve, providing students with easy access to vital resources is essential. A well-structured resource directory can facilitate this access and support student success. This article outlines how to build a comprehensive resource directory tailored to student needs.
1. Identify Key Resources
The first step in building a resource directory is identifying what types of resources students need. This may include links to academic databases, tutoring services, study tools, and mental health resources.
2. Organize by Category
Once you've compiled a list of resources, organize them into categories that make sense for your audience. For instance, you might have sections for academic support, extracurricular activities, and wellness resources.

4. Ensure Accessibility
Make sure that your resource directory is easily accessible to students. Consider placing it on a student portal or a frequently visited section of your website.
5. Gather Feedback
Solicit feedback from students and educators to continually improve your resource directory. This ensures that the directory remains relevant and useful over time.
